n8n has XSS in Chat Trigger Node through Custom CSS

Description

Impact

An authenticated user with permission to create or modify workflows could inject malicious JavaScript into the Custom CSS field of the Chat Trigger node. Due to a misconfiguration in the sanitize-html library, the sanitization could be bypassed, resulting in stored XSS on the public chat page. Any user visiting the chat URL would be affected.

Patches

The issue has been fixed in n8n versions 1.123.27, 2.13.3, and 2.14.1. Users should upgrade to one of these versions or later to remediate the vulnerability.

Workarounds

If upgrading is not immediately possible, administrators should consider the following temporary mitigations:

  • Limit workflow creation and editing permissions to fully trusted users only.
  • Disable the Chat Trigger node by adding @n8n/n8n-nodes-langchain.chatTrigger to the NODES_EXCLUDE environment variable.

These workarounds do not fully remediate the risk and should only be used as short-term mitigation measures.
